  30. #include "EPD_Test.h"
  31. #include "EPD_7in5_V2_old.h"
  32. #include <time.h>
  33. int EPD_test(void)
  34. {
  35. printf("EPD_7IN5_V2_test Demo\r\n");
  36. if(DEV_Module_Init()!=0){
  37. return -1;
  38. }
  39. printf("e-Paper Init and Clear...\r\n");
  40. EPD_7IN5_V2_Init();
  41. EPD_7IN5_V2_Clear();
  42. DEV_Delay_ms(500);
  43. //Create a new image cache
  44. UBYTE *BlackImage;
  45. /* you have to edit the startup_stm32fxxx.s file and set a big enough heap size */
  46. UWORD Imagesize = ((EPD_7IN5_V2_WIDTH % 8 == 0)? (EPD_7IN5_V2_WIDTH / 8 ): (EPD_7IN5_V2_WIDTH / 8 + 1)) * EPD_7IN5_V2_HEIGHT;
  47. if((BlackImage = (UBYTE *)malloc(Imagesize)) == NULL) {
  48. printf("Failed to apply for black memory...\r\n");
  49. return -1;
  50. }
  51. printf("Paint_NewImage\r\n");
  52. Paint_NewImage(BlackImage, EPD_7IN5_V2_WIDTH, EPD_7IN5_V2_HEIGHT, 0, WHITE);
  53. #if 1 // show image for array
  54. printf("show image for array\r\n");
  55. EPD_7IN5_V2_Init_Fast();
  56. Paint_SelectImage(BlackImage);
  57. Paint_Clear(WHITE);
  58. Paint_DrawBitMap(gImage_7in5_V2);
  59. EPD_7IN5_V2_Display(BlackImage);
  60. DEV_Delay_ms(2000);
  61. #endif
  62. #if 1 // Drawing on the image
  63. //1.Select Image
  64. printf("SelectImage:BlackImage\r\n");
  65. EPD_7IN5_V2_Init_Fast();
  66. Paint_SelectImage(BlackImage);
  67. Paint_Clear(WHITE);
  68. // 2.Drawing on the image
  69. printf("Drawing:BlackImage\r\n");
  70. Paint_DrawPoint(10, 80, BLACK, DOT_PIXEL_1X1, DOT_STYLE_DFT);
  71. Paint_DrawPoint(10, 90, BLACK, DOT_PIXEL_2X2, DOT_STYLE_DFT);
  72. Paint_DrawPoint(10, 100, BLACK, DOT_PIXEL_3X3, DOT_STYLE_DFT);
  73. Paint_DrawLine(20, 70, 70, 120, BLACK, DOT_PIXEL_1X1, LINE_STYLE_SOLID);
  74. Paint_DrawLine(70, 70, 20, 120, BLACK, DOT_PIXEL_1X1, LINE_STYLE_SOLID);
  75. Paint_DrawRectangle(20, 70, 70, 120, BLACK, DOT_PIXEL_1X1, DRAW_FILL_EMPTY);
  76. Paint_DrawRectangle(80, 70, 130, 120, BLACK, DOT_PIXEL_1X1, DRAW_FILL_FULL);
  77. Paint_DrawCircle(45, 95, 20, BLACK, DOT_PIXEL_1X1, DRAW_FILL_EMPTY);
  78. Paint_DrawCircle(105, 95, 20, WHITE, DOT_PIXEL_1X1, DRAW_FILL_FULL);
  79. Paint_DrawLine(85, 95, 125, 95, BLACK, DOT_PIXEL_1X1, LINE_STYLE_DOTTED);
  80. Paint_DrawLine(105, 75, 105, 115, BLACK, DOT_PIXEL_1X1, LINE_STYLE_DOTTED);
  81. Paint_DrawString_EN(10, 0, "waveshare", &Font16, BLACK, WHITE);
  82. Paint_DrawString_EN(10, 20, "hello world", &Font12, WHITE, BLACK);
  83. Paint_DrawNum(10, 33, 123456789, &Font12, BLACK, WHITE);
  84. Paint_DrawNum(10, 50, 987654321, &Font16, WHITE, BLACK);
  85. Paint_DrawString_CN(130, 0, "ÄãºÃabc", &Font12CN, BLACK, WHITE);
  86. Paint_DrawString_CN(130, 20, "΢ѩµç×Ó", &Font24CN, WHITE, BLACK);
  87. printf("EPD_Display\r\n");
  88. EPD_7IN5_V2_Display(BlackImage);
  89. DEV_Delay_ms(2000);
  90. #endif
  91. #if 1 //Partial refresh, example shows time
  92. EPD_7IN5_V2_Init_Partial();
  93. Paint_NewImage(BlackImage, Font20.Width * 7, Font20.Height, 0, WHITE);
  94. Debug("Partial refresh\r\n");
  95. Paint_SelectImage(BlackImage);
  96. Paint_Clear(WHITE);
  97. PAINT_TIME sPaint_time;
  98. sPaint_time.Hour = 12;
  99. sPaint_time.Min = 34;
  100. sPaint_time.Sec = 56;
  101. UBYTE num = 10;
  102. for (;;) {
  103. sPaint_time.Sec = sPaint_time.Sec + 1;
  104. if (sPaint_time.Sec == 60) {
  105. sPaint_time.Min = sPaint_time.Min + 1;
  106. sPaint_time.Sec = 0;
  107. if (sPaint_time.Min == 60) {
  108. sPaint_time.Hour = sPaint_time.Hour + 1;
  109. sPaint_time.Min = 0;
  110. if (sPaint_time.Hour == 24) {
  111. sPaint_time.Hour = 0;
  112. sPaint_time.Min = 0;
  113. sPaint_time.Sec = 0;
  114. }
  115. }
  116. }
  117. Paint_ClearWindows(0, 0, Font20.Width * 7, Font20.Height, WHITE);
  118. Paint_DrawTime(0, 0, &sPaint_time, &Font20, WHITE, BLACK);
  119. num = num - 1;
  120. if(num == 0) {
  121. break;
  122. }
  123. EPD_7IN5_V2_Display_Partial(BlackImage, 150, 80, 150 + Font20.Width * 7, 80 + Font20.Height);
  124. DEV_Delay_ms(500);//Analog clock 1s
  125. }
  126. #endif
  127. printf("Clear...\r\n");
  128. EPD_7IN5_V2_Init();
  129. EPD_7IN5_V2_Clear();
  130. printf("Goto Sleep...\r\n");
  131. EPD_7IN5_V2_Sleep();
  132. free(BlackImage);
  133. BlackImage = NULL;
  134. DEV_Delay_ms(2000);//important, at least 2s
  135. // close 5V
  136. printf("close 5V, Module enters 0 power consumption ...\r\n");
  137. DEV_Module_Exit();
  138. return 0;
  139. }
